Output 510649ad89c809614da13836cd82b55942844098b84a3b2205bcb23cefda69db:0
- value
- 672576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 764bcb2189cc09f7d072f8b703123022d8d72926 OP_EQUAL
- address
- 3CUWTQLFhpPVMgZwjTudu8A8dvc1bkAYnU
- transaction
- 510649ad89c809614da13836cd82b55942844098b84a3b2205bcb23cefda69db
- confirmations
- 386879
- spent
- true